Job Summary:
This role involves performing ultrasound examinations on a variety of patients in a critical access magnet hospital setting. The Ultrasound Technician will work a 5x8-hour day shift Monday through Friday with on-call responsibilities one weekday night per week and every fourth weekend. The position requires ARDMS certification and a current state license.
Location: Jacksonville Illinois United States
Responsibilities:
- Performing ultrasound examinations across various specialties (adult ER ICU obstetrics pediatrics portables).
- Utilizing PACS and Siemens equipment.
- Performing on-call duties as scheduled (one weekday night per week and every fourth weekend).
- Maintaining accurate patient records.
- Adhering to hospital protocols and safety standards.
- Collaborating with other healthcare professionals.
Required Skills & Certifications:
- ARDMS certification.
- Active state license as an Ultrasound Technician.
Preferred Skills & Certifications:
- Experience in adult ER ICU obstetrics pediatrics and portable ultrasound.
- Proficiency with PACS and Siemens equipment.
- Experience with various ultrasound specialties (abdominal OB/GYN neonatal renal/pelvis small parts vascular).
- Knowledge of isolation precautions.
Special Considerations:
- On-call responsibilities: one weekday night per week (12:30 AM - 7:00 AM) and every fourth weekend (00:30 AM Saturday - 06:00 AM Monday).
- Guaranteed hours with potential for call-offs up to 36 hours per 13-week assignment without pay. Additional call-offs will be billed to the client. On-call shifts count as call-offs.
- RTO restrictions: ideally no more than 5 days.
- No floating between departments.
- Block scheduling can be discussed with the manager.
Scheduling:
- 5x8-hour day shift Monday-Friday 7:00 AM - 3:30 PM.
- On-call rotation as described above.
